We are currently recruiting for: Secure Support Worker
Hours of work: 38 hours per week
Location of role: St Helens, Merseyside

Salary range: £24,909 - £27,317 per year, pro rata

Secure Care Worker - Join Our Team and Make a Difference

We are a nationwide provider of secure and open care facilities, dedicated to supporting young people aged 10-17 in crisis. Our primary mission is to protect and support these young individuals through their challenges, guiding them toward a brighter future.

We are currently recruiting Secure Care Workers who will play a crucial role in delivering compassionate and respectful care to the children and young people in our services. This role will involve a variety of duties, with a primary focus on either intervention work or activity work, depending on your skills and experience.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ide outstanding care to young people in a secure environment, offering protection and guidance through times of crisis.
  • Support young people in achieving the best outcomes, focusing on areas such as education, health, independence, and building self-confidence.
  • Foster an environment of optimism, compassion, and respect while recognizing and addressing the individual struggles that young people face.
  • Work collaboratively as part of a dedicated team to make a lasting difference in the lives of the young people in our care.
